Control Arm Replacement A Comprehensive Guide
The control arm is a vital component of a vehicle's suspension system. It connects the chassis of the vehicle to the wheel assembly, allowing for smooth handling and stability while driving. Over time, control arms can wear out or become damaged due to various factors, including road conditions, driving habits, and the vehicle's overall age. Replacing a worn or damaged control arm is essential for maintaining optimal vehicle performance and safety.
Signs of a Failing Control Arm
Before diving into the replacement process, it's crucial to recognize the signs of a failing control arm. Common indicators include
1. Unusual Noises Clunking, squeaking, or popping sounds while driving, especially over bumps or rough terrain, can signal that the control arm bushings or joints are worn out.
2. Steering Issues If you notice that your vehicle pulls to one side or has a loose, vague steering feel, it may indicate control arm problems.
3. Uneven Tire Wear A failing control arm can lead to improper wheel alignment, causing uneven tire wear. If you notice bald spots or significant wear on one side of the tires, it may be time to inspect the control arms.
4. Visible Damage A thorough examination of the suspension components may reveal rust, cracks, or other damage to the control arms themselves.
Preparing for Replacement
Before replacing the control arm, gather the necessary tools and parts. You will typically need
- A socket set - A wrench set - Pliers - A jack and jack stands - A replacement control arm (ensure it matches your vehicle's specifications) - New bushings and hardware, if required
Safety is paramount when performing any automotive repairs
. Make sure to work on a level surface, engage the parking brake, and use jack stands to support the vehicle properly.Step-by-Step Replacement Process
1. Lift the Vehicle Use a jack to lift the front or rear of the vehicle, depending on which control arm you are replacing. Secure it with jack stands.
2. Remove the Wheel Take off the wheel to access the control arm assembly easily.
3. Disconnect the Control Arm Identify the bolts and nuts connecting the control arm to the frame and the steering knuckle. Use a wrench or socket to remove them. It’s advisable to keep the bolts organized for easy reassembly.
4. Remove the Old Control Arm Once the fasteners are removed, gently pull the control arm away from the vehicle. If it’s stuck, you may need to tap it lightly with a hammer.
5. Install the New Control Arm Position the new control arm in place, aligning it with the mounting points. Start threading the bolts by hand before tightening them with a wrench.
6. Reattach the Wheel Once the control arm is securely fastened, put the wheel back on and hand-tighten the lug nuts.
7. Lower the Vehicle Carefully remove the jack stands and lower the vehicle back to the ground.
8. Torqueing Bolts After lowering the vehicle, it is essential to torque the control arm bolts to the manufacturer's specifications to ensure a secure fit.
9. Get a Wheel Alignment After replacing the control arm, it is crucial to have a professional wheel alignment performed. This ensures that your vehicle handles properly and prolongs tire life.
